  1. B-Donate gently used books to the public library.
  2. B-Return overdue books before Winter Break.
  3. O-Checkout a cookbook and make your family a treat!
  4. O-"Clean up" a bookshelf for Ms Hubbard
  5. B-Read for 15 minutes
  6. O-Read for 45 minutes
  7. O-Design/ color a bookmark for Ms. Hubbard to give to students.
  8. I-"Clean up" your ELA teacher's classroom library.
  9. N-Ask a teacher about what they are reading.
  10. I-Record a First Chapter Friday episode for Ms. Hubbard.
  11. N-Read a picture book to a family member that is younger than you.
  12. G-Read for 10 minutes
  13. I-Read for 20 minutes
  14. G-Read a picture book to a family member that is older than you.
  15. O-Visit the public library - ask a librarian to recommend a book to you.
  16. I-Help a classmate locate a book in our library.
  17. I-Write a book review for Ms. Hubbard
  18. B-Ask an EPMS principal about what they are reading.
  19. G-Talk about your favorite book to people at lunch.
  20. N-Recommend a Non-Fiction book to your SS, SCI or Math teacher.
  21. G-Leave a friendly note in a library book.
  22. B-Visit the public library and help a family member find a book.
  23. G-Checkout an Origami book and make something for a friend.
  24. N-Read for 30 minutes
